  15. (Picture) (Download) http://ryu1sou.blog.fc2.com/ (Comment) Minecraft Steve. He's such a crafting master at this point that he is not only a sworduser, but also can generate iron ore and sticks with his sword in battle, by poking the enemy or slamming the diamond sword into the ground. Normal sword strikes make the cursor in his inventory move over a space. By utilizing these sword strikes in various patterns, he can craft a variety of Minecraft items that act as his hypers. His only other non-item hyper is refueling that meat meter, which must be a form of stamina. It drains as he performs attacks, and he cannot attack if it is near empty. He has a basic punch and kick as well. His 7th palette is a hidden joke mode too. Made by ryu1sou.
